Multiple outlets report that Agnes, a Brisbane restaurant often cited as a top contender in local dining rankings, is changing up its menu. The coverage notes that the restaurant has built a reputation for consistent high quality, prompting the question of why it would adjust offerings that have proven successful. While the articles focus on the rationale for the update, they also treat the shift as part of the restaurant’s ongoing evolution rather than a retreat from its established style. The reporting is broadly aligned in describing the same development—an updated menu following a period of consistent acclaim—without presenting conflicting accounts about who is behind the change or whether it affects the restaurant’s standing. Overall, the sources indicate that diners can expect new or modified dishes as Agnes refreshes its menu while maintaining the qualities that have contributed to its reputation.
